RS-098 Skateboarding
The RS-098 Skateboarding is a California MUTCD recreational & cultural interest sign. FHWA has not yet issued SHS spec drawings for the RS series; the official depiction is MUTCD Chapter 2M (Figure 2M-8), where the symbol is captioned “Skateboarding”. It appears in both the 2009 and 11th Edition (2023) MUTCD Chapter 2M figures.

Used in California per the CA MUTCD; the official depiction is MUTCD Chapter 2M (Figure 2M-8) — FHWA has not issued a standalone SHS drawing for the RS series. Confirm size, retroreflective sheeting, and placement for the condition and the reviewing agency. Dimensions are not asserted here.
In Los Angeles, this sign must conform to the CA MUTCD. Work in City of LA right-of-way is reviewed by StreetsLA and the Bureau of Engineering; state highways in LA County are permitted by Caltrans District 7; county roads by LA County DPW.
